High rev missfire

Has anyone had a high rev missfire? When I accelerate fully, the check engine light comes on and then the car starts to miss. I turn the car off and after a few minutes or hours the miss goes away but the check engine lamp remains. I have had it to a MB mechanic and they want to change the plugs in #2 cylinder. To me this looks like a fishing expedition to find my Visa card, they really do not know how much the repair will cost and if that will indead repair the problem. I took it to Fleecer Jones and they want about $100-250 to diagnose the problem, then no one knows if the extended warranty will cover the repair. German Motors said that if I replaced all the spark plugs the labor would be $850 and the plugs $240, almost $1,100 to change the plugs!!

I have had a plug foul out before but never have I seen it "get better", once it is fouled it does not work. So why would they want to replace the plug?This is a mystry to me. The Beru 14 F 7-DPUR X 2 plugs are also hard to find, they had to order them from California.
